Small Business Resources

The BVCOG Economic & Community Development program has identified a variety of small business resources for the Brazos Valley Community.

  • Revolving Loan Fund - The Revolving Loan Fund is designed to support business activities when a full amount of needed credit is unavailable from a financial institution.

  • Small Business Development Center - Provide business advising for start-up & existing businesses, webinars, business training and assist with loan application documents. 

  • USDA Rural Business Development Grant - This program is designed for communities and towns to request funds to provide technical assistance and training for small rural businesses. Small means that the business has fewer than 50 new workers and less than $1 million in gross revenue.

  • Section 3 Business Registry  - Per HUD.GOV, this is a searchable online database that lists firms that meet the definition of a Section 3 business. This list can be used by agencies that receive HUD funds to facilitate the award of HUD-funded contracts and can be used by Section 3 residents to identify businesses that may have HUD-funded employment opportunities.
